U.S. stock futures remained largely unchanged in overnight trading as June began, with markets near record highs and broad participation across sectors.

Sustained market strength across multiple sectors may indicate continued investor optimism and resilience, influencing investment strategies and economic outlooks.

Market participants will monitor trading in the coming days to see if the rally continues and if broader sector participation persists.
